Garage Wallboard Installation in Denver, CO
Garage wallboard installation services involve adding finished wall surfaces to garage interiors to improve appearance, durability, and functionality. This service is often requested for projects such as creating a more polished look, hiding existing structural elements or insulation, and establishing a clean backdrop for storage solutions or workshop areas. Property owners typically want to understand the types of wallboard materials available, the process involved, and how the installation can enhance the usability and aesthetics of their garage space.
Before requesting garage wallboard installation, homeowners should consider the condition of existing walls, the level of moisture or temperature control needed, and the desired finish. It’s also helpful to clarify whether the project includes insulation, electrical considerations, or specific design preferences. Understanding these factors can ensure the completed wall surfaces meet both functional needs and personal style expectations.

Garage Wallboard Installation Questions
What is garage wallboard installation? It involves attaching durable wall panels to garage walls to improve appearance and protect surfaces.
What types of wallboards are available? Common options include drywall, PVC panels, and fiber cement boards, each suited for different needs and finishes.
Can garage wallboards be customized? Yes, wallboards can be painted, textured, or finished to match the property's style and preferences.
Is garage wallboard installation suitable for all garages? It is suitable for most garages, especially when aiming to enhance durability and organization.
